WONDERS - European Science Festival 2006

EUSCEA organises the first EUROPEAN SCIENCE FESTIVAL 2006 - acronym WONDERS (Welcome to Observations, News & Demonstrations of European Research and Science) with a "Carousel of Science", an exchange between about 21 science communication events in Europe, with CliClim, a European Survey "Click for the Climate" with the possibility to pledge actions to save energy and preserve the environment - starting with a Launch Conference in Vienna, Austria, on March 30 and 31 - ending with the Finals at Heureka in Vantaa, Finland, where the "best of the best" activities of the "Carousel" will be chosen.

Project Management Team (PMT)

If you have any questions, you can either turn to the coordinator or to a member of the Project Management Team, if it concerns their responsibility:

Mikkel Bohm, DK: Operation of the Carousel and Carousel at the Finals (selection of "the Best of the Best")

Paula Havaste, FI: Finals Event in Vantaa, Finland, and for the cooperation with the science centres and museums

István Palugyai, H: Science Cafés; support on all kinds of media

Peter Rebernik, A: Coordinator; Launch Event in Vienna; project's website

Jan Riise, S: Marketing support, Partners' Manual and EUSCOS, the European Science Communication Strategy

Annette Smith, UK: CliClim ("Click for the Climate") and evaluation of the whole WONDERS project
